Monique Pena is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Plant Science and Immunology. According to data from OpenAlex, Monique Pena has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Molecular Biology, 2 papers in Plant Science and 2 papers in Immunology. Recurrent topics in Monique Pena’s work include Neuroinflammation and Neurodegeneration Mechanisms (2 papers), Genomics and Chromatin Dynamics (2 papers) and Chromosomal and Genetic Variations (2 papers). Monique Pena is often cited by papers focused on Neuroinflammation and Neurodegeneration Mechanisms (2 papers), Genomics and Chromatin Dynamics (2 papers) and Chromosomal and Genetic Variations (2 papers). Monique Pena collaborates with scholars based in United States, Germany and Italy. Monique Pena's co-authors include Fred H. Gage, Christopher K. Glass, Baptiste N. Jaeger, David Gosselin, Johannes C. M. Schlachetzki, Amy Adair, Martina P. Pasillas, Michael L. Levy, Conor Fitzpatrick and Dylan Skola and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Cell and Journal of Neuroscience.
